Since 2011 I was happy with my ProDigy CUBE 24/96 USB soundcard. I've got absolutely no any headache with onboard codec drivers, all was running nice out of box.

Unfortunately, after updating to El Capitan (and to Sierra further) I've got issues with my soundcard. After 5-10 minutes of playing, the sound quality is dropping completely and music plays with lag and crippled quality. Only dropping sample rate to 16000hz saves me, but It sounds very poor.
In System's Console I see a lot of USB sound assertion for my device before quality is going poor.

After months of googling I figured out that many of USB soundcards are incompatible with new AppleUSBAudio driver.
Would you advice me any inexpensive (<100$) USB sound card which plays well with OSX Sierra?
